Apakah Aplikasi Android Menggunakan Java

Java adalah bahasa default untuk menulis aplikasi Android sejak platform Android diperkenalkan pada tahun 2008. Java mengkompilasi ke “bytecode” yang ditafsirkan pada saat runtime oleh Java Virtual Machine (JVM) yang mendasarinya yang berjalan di OS. Anda menulis aplikasi seluler di Java dan memprogramnya dengan Android SDK.

Apakah Java wajib untuk Android?

Java adalah cara standar untuk menulis aplikasi Android, tetapi itu tidak sepenuhnya diperlukan. Misalnya, ada juga Xamarin. Android yang memungkinkan Anda menulis aplikasi Android di C# – meskipun masih menjalankan Dalvik VM di belakang layar, karena kontrol “asli” Android ada di Java. Menggunakan Java mungkin merupakan opsi paling sederhana.

Apakah Kotlin lebih mudah daripada Java?

Membuat Aplikasi Modular di Java sangat mudah dan karena memiliki fitur seperti reusability, membuat kode lebih kuat. Java cukup sederhana untuk menangani dan menghapus bug darinya menjadi lebih mudah jika dibandingkan dengan Kotlin. Standar keamanan di Java memiliki kualitas yang lebih tinggi daripada Kotlin.

Apakah Facebook menggunakan Java?

Facebook menggunakan beberapa bahasa berbeda untuk layanannya yang berbeda. PHP digunakan untuk front-end, Erlang digunakan untuk Obrolan, Java dan C++ juga digunakan di beberapa tempat (dan mungkin bahasa lain juga). Facebook telah menjadikan Thrift open source dan dukungan untuk lebih banyak bahasa telah ditambahkan.

Haruskah saya mulai dengan Java atau Kotlin?

Secara umum, karena pengumuman Mei 2019 dari Google, saya akan merekomendasikan pemula di pengembangan aplikasi Android dimulai dengan Kotlin namun ada beberapa pengecualian di mana menurut saya Java mungkin lebih baik. Ada dua skenario yang saya sarankan untuk mempelajari Java terlebih dahulu untuk pengembangan aplikasi Android sebagai pemula.

Apakah Gmail ditulis dalam Java?

2 Jawaban. Bahasa resmi Google adalah Java, Python, C++ dan JavaScript yang saya percaya. Saya akan kagum jika mereka menggunakan .

Apakah Java diperlukan untuk Kotlin?

Kotlin 100% dapat dioperasikan dengan bahasa pemrograman Java dan penekanan utama telah diberikan untuk memastikan bahwa basis kode Anda yang ada dapat berinteraksi dengan baik dengan Kotlin. Anda dapat dengan mudah memanggil kode Kotlin dari Java dan kode Java dari Kotlin.

Apakah Kotlin Menggantikan Java?

Sudah beberapa tahun sejak Kotlin keluar, dan itu berjalan dengan baik. Karena dibuat khusus untuk menggantikan Java, Kotlin secara alami telah dibandingkan dengan Java dalam banyak hal.

Apakah Google menggunakan Java?

Di sisi lain, Anda juga tidak mungkin memahami arsitektur komputer jika Anda tidak tahu C++. Sejauh bekerja di sana, Google menggunakan Java dan C++. Mereka memiliki sedikit alasan untuk memilih salah satu dari yang lain. Dan, yang lebih penting, bahasa tidak terlalu penting.

Apakah aplikasi Android ditulis dalam Java?

Bahasa resmi untuk pengembangan Android adalah Java. Sebagian besar Android ditulis dalam Java dan API-nya dirancang untuk dipanggil terutama dari Java. Dimungkinkan untuk mengembangkan aplikasi C dan C++ menggunakan Android Native Development Kit (NDK), namun itu bukan sesuatu yang dipromosikan Google.

Mengapa aplikasi Android menggunakan Java?

Java melindungi Anda dari banyak masalah yang melekat pada kode asli, seperti kebocoran memori, penggunaan pointer yang buruk, dll. Java memungkinkan mereka untuk membuat aplikasi kotak pasir, dan membuat model keamanan yang lebih baik sehingga satu Aplikasi yang buruk tidak dapat menghapus seluruh OS Anda .

Apakah bahasa Jawa sulit dipelajari?

Dibandingkan dengan bahasa pemrograman lain, Java cukup mudah dipelajari. Tentu saja, ini bukan hal yang mudah, tetapi Anda dapat mempelajarinya dengan cepat jika Anda mau berusaha. Ini adalah bahasa pemrograman yang ramah untuk pemula. Melalui tutorial java apa pun, Anda akan belajar bagaimana berorientasi objek itu.

Apa kelebihan Jawa?

Kelebihan Java Java adalah Simple. Java adalah bahasa Pemrograman Berorientasi Objek. Java adalah bahasa yang aman. Java murah dan ekonomis untuk dipelihara. Java adalah platform-independen. Java mendukung fitur portabilitas. Java menyediakan Pengumpulan Sampah Otomatis. Java mendukung Multithreading.

Apakah Java digunakan dalam pengembangan aplikasi seluler?

Pengembangan Aplikasi Java Meskipun Java memiliki banyak kesalahan, Java masih merupakan bahasa paling populer untuk pengembangan Android karena dijalankan pada mesin virtual. Sebagai opsi berorientasi objek untuk pengembangan seluler, Java biasanya digunakan untuk mengembangkan aplikasi Android.

Bagaimana C++ berbeda dari Java?

C++ adalah bahasa pemrograman prosedural dan berorientasi objek. Oleh karena itu, C++ memiliki fitur khusus untuk bahasa prosedural serta fitur bahasa pemrograman berorientasi objek. Java adalah bahasa pemrograman yang sepenuhnya berorientasi objek. C++ memungkinkan panggilan langsung ke pustaka sistem asli.

Apakah Java lebih baik daripada Kotlin?

Deployment Aplikasi Kotlin lebih cepat dikompilasi, ringan, dan mencegah ukuran aplikasi bertambah. Setiap potongan kode yang ditulis dalam Kotlin jauh lebih kecil dibandingkan dengan Java, karena lebih sedikit verbose dan lebih sedikit kode berarti lebih sedikit bug. Kotlin mengkompilasi kode ke bytecode yang dapat dieksekusi di JVM.

Haruskah saya menggunakan Kotlin atau Java untuk Android?

Untuk sebagian besar, kekuatan Kotlin lebih besar daripada kemunduran bahasa. Ada batasan tertentu dalam Java yang menghambat desain Android API. Kotlin secara inheren ringan, bersih, dan jauh lebih sedikit verbose, terutama dalam hal penulisan callback, kelas data, dan getter/setter.

Bisakah saya belajar Kotlin tanpa Java?

Rodionische: Pengetahuan tentang Java bukanlah suatu keharusan. Ya, tetapi tidak hanya OOP juga hal-hal kecil lainnya yang Kotlin sembunyikan dari Anda (karena sebagian besar adalah kode pelat ketel, tetapi masih sesuatu yang harus Anda ketahui ada di sana, mengapa ada di sana dan bagaimana cara kerjanya). 21 April 2016.

Apakah Google menggunakan Python?

Peter Norvig, Ilmuwan Komputer dan Direktur Riset di Google mengatakan, “Python telah menjadi bagian penting dari Google sejak awal, dan tetap demikian seiring dengan pertumbuhan dan perkembangan sistem. Saat ini lusinan insinyur Google menggunakan Python, dan kami mencari lebih banyak orang dengan keterampilan dalam bahasa ini.”.

Related Posts